It was mentioned before the problem is time zone differences. No advertiser is going to pay the money they fork out for an afternoon game. For that kind of money they will demand the prime time slot. There just isn't any way to do it. If the game begins at 8 pm London it will be 3 pm on the East Coast and Noon on the West Coast. I don't know about Daylight Savings Time in London. Here the times would change by an hour.

Point is the game would have to be played in the middle of the night to reach the American audience in the late afternoon and early evening time that is required.
